A method that loads the text file or blob and returns a promise that
resolves to an array of Document instances. It reads the text from
the file or blob using the readFile function from the
node:fs/promises module or the text() method of the blob. It then
parses the text using the parse() method and creates a Document
instance for each parsed page. The metadata includes the source of the
text (file path or blob) and, if there are multiple pages, the line
number of each page.
A promise that resolves to an array of Document instances.

A class that extends the
BaseDocumentLoaderclass. It represents a document loader that loads documents from a text file. Theload()method is implemented to read the text from the file or blob, parse it using theparse()method, and create aDocumentinstance for each parsed page. The metadata includes the source of the text (file path or blob) and, if there are multiple pages, the line number of each page.Example
